			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We are excited to share news of a community project with you, and invite you to join our expanding circle of participation and support.</p>
<p>Circles for Peace is a Vermont grassroots non-profit organization that is based on the philosophy that inner peace and inner strength can be restored by witnessing the rhythms and cycles of nature.</p>
<p>Our first project is The Burlington Earth Clock. </p>
<p>We are building The Burlington Earth Clock on land provided by the Burlington Parks Department at Blanchard Beach on the bike path just north of Oakledge Park (a popular spot for watching the sunset).</p>
<p>Plans include the development of an educational curriculum for K-12 in the areas of science and math, art and history.</p>
<p>We are currently fundraising to complete landscaping, install information signs and the 6&#8242; granite sundial in the middle of the circle.</p>
